Output 53c05b3ca8a93caf6d8ef7154a4b138236f13fd40bba1f0f6f0c5407319efc98:1

value
21970586
script pubkey
OP_0 OP_PUSHBYTES_20 3eafb10be232d46d940a86505941ad396b683bde
address
bc1q86hmzzlzxt2xm9q2seg9jsdd894ksw775ak4e5
transaction
53c05b3ca8a93caf6d8ef7154a4b138236f13fd40bba1f0f6f0c5407319efc98
spent
true